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up packed br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• 2 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ice
  • 1/2 teaspoon fine sea salt
  • 1/2 cup very cold salted butter, diced or grated
  • 3/4 cup pumpkin purée
  • 1/3 cup buttermilk (or milk), plus extra for brushing
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 2 to 3 teaspoons buttermilk (or milk)
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• optional: 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on, ginger or cardamom

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, whisk together flour, brown sugar, baking powder, cinnamon, pumpkin pie spice, and salt.
  3. Cut in the cold butter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  4. Stir in pumpkin purée, buttermilk, and vanilla until just combined; avoid over-mixing.
  5. Turn the dough onto a floured surface and shape it into an 8-inch circle. Cut into 8 wedges.
  6. Freeze the wedges for about 15 minutes before baking.
  7. Brush tops with buttermilk and bake for 13-15 minutes until golden.
  8. For glaze, mix powdered sugar with buttermilk and vanilla; drizzle over cooled scones before serving.
